CONNECTIONS
 
 
The TV SoundConnect (SoundShare) function is supported by some Samsung TVs released from 2012 on. 
Check whether your TV supports the TV SoundConnect (SoundShare) function before you begin.  
(For further information, refer to the TV’s user manual.).
 
If your Samsung TV was released before 2014, check the SoundShare setting menu.
 
If the distance between the TV and Soundbar exceeds 32.8 ft, the connection may not be stable or the 
audio may stutter. If this occurs, relocate the TV or Soundbar so that they are within operational range, and 
then re-establish the TV SoundConnect connection.
 
TV SoundConnect Operational Ranges:
 - Recommended pairing range: within 78.7 inches.
 - Recommended operational range: within 32.8 ft.
 
The Play/Pause, Next, and Prev buttons on the Soundbar or Soundbar's remote do not control the TV.
CONNECTING TO EXTERNAL DEVICES
HDMI CABLE
HDMI is the standard digital interface for connecting to TVs, projectors, DVD players, Blu-ray players, set top boxes, 
and more.  
HDMI prevents any degradation to the signal due to conversion to analog and maintains the video and audio 
quality of the original digital source.
